If Brady & Mathew knows that it will sell many of these cameras, should it expect to make or lose money from sell them? How much?

Answers

Given:

• Profit per camera = $186

,

• Cost of replacing the camera = $3100

,

• Probability it will be replaced once = 4% = 0.04

,

• Probability it will be replaced twice = 1% = 0.01

,

• Probability it will not be replaced = 95% = 0.95

Now, let's determine if the company should expect to make money or lose money from selling the camera.

Let's find the expected cost of repair.

We have:

E = (0.04 x 3100) + (0.01 x 2 x 3100) + (0.95 x 0)

E = 124 + 62 + 0

E = 186

Therefore, the expected cost of repair is $186.

We can see the profit per camera and the expected cost of repair are the same.

Profit per camera = Expected cost of repair

Since they are equal, the company should expect to neither make nor lose money from selling these cameras.

ANSWER:

Brady & Matthew should expect to neither make nor lose money from selling these cameras.

Use the model of the rectangular prism to answer the question. The width of the
prism is (2x - 2) ft, and its height is (x + 7) ft. The area of the base of the prism is
(3x2 + 3x - 4) ft².

Could the length of b be (3x - 1) ft? Complete the explanation.

Answers

Answer:

[tex]\textsf{$\boxed{\sf No}$\;. The area of the bottom face of the prism is $(3x^2+3x-4)\; \sf ft^2$, and the product}[/tex]

[tex]\textsf{of $(3x-1)$\;ft\;and $\left(\; \boxed{2}\:x-\boxed{2}\;\right)$ ft\;is\;$\left(\; \boxed{6}\:x^2-\boxed{8}\:x+\boxed{2}\;\right)$\;ft$^2$.}[/tex]

Step-by-step explanation:

Given dimensions of a rectangular prism:

Width = (2x - 2) ftHeight = (x + 7) ftArea of the base = (3x² + 3x - 4) ft²

The area of the base of a rectangular prism is the product of the width of the base and the length of the base.

To determine if length b could be (3x - 1) ft, multiply b by the width of the base of the prism.

[tex]\begin{aligned}\implies \sf Area\;of\;base&=\sf length \times width\\&=b \times (2x-2)\\&=(3x-1)(2x-2)\\&=3x(2x-2)-1(2x-2)\\&=6x^2-6x-2x+2\\&=6x^2-8x+2\end{aligned}[/tex]

Therefore, the length of b cannot be (3x - 1) as the area of the base when b is (3x - 1) is not equal to the given area of the base.
